dc.description.abstractThe effect of infill walls to stiffness of the structures has been known for a long time and this effect has taken many of the earthquake regulations with empirical relationships and equations into account. However, in strength-based calculations, buildings are taken as bare frames and infill walls are effected as vertical load to system, whereas infill walls contribute to stiffness at the beginning of the earthquake and help meet seismic loads by incurring damage during an earthquake. In this study, contribution of infill walls to stiffness of the structure was analyzed in reinforced concrete framed and load-bearing buildings. Also, the effect of openings in the infill walls to stiffness was examined.en
